Operations
6-12
C141-E171-03EN
6.4 Read-ahead Cache
Read-ahead Cache is the function for automatically reading data blocks upon
completion of the read command in order to read data from disk media and save
data block on a data buffer.
If a subsequent command requests reading of the read-ahead data, data on the data
buffer can be transferred without accessing the disk media. As the result, faster
data access becomes possible for the host.
6.4.1 Data buffer structure
This device contains a data buffer of 2 MB. This buffer is divided into two areas:
one area is used for MPU work, and the other is used as a read cache for another
command. (See Figure 6.7.)
For MPU work
For R/W command
2048 KB (2097152 bytes)
0.5 KB
(512 bytes)
1984 KB
(2031616 bytes)
63.5 KB
(65024 bytes)
For MPU work
Figure 6.7 Data buffer structure
The read-ahead operation is performed while the READ SECTOR (S) or READ
MULTIPLE or READ DMA command is in progress. Read-ahead data is stored
in the read cache part of the buffer.
6.4.2 Caching operation
The caching operation is performed only when the commands listed below are
received. If any of the following data are stored on the data buffer, the data is
sent to the host system.
•
All of the sector data that this command processes.
•
A part of the sector data including the start sector, that this command
processes.
If part of the data to be processed is stored on the data buffer, the remaining data
is read from disk media and sent to the host system.
Summary of Contents for MHS2020AT
Page 1: ...C141 E171 03EN MHS2060AT MHS2040AT MHS2030AT MHS2020AT DISK DRIVES PRODUCT MANUAL ...
Page 4: ...This page is intentionally left blank ...
Page 8: ...This page is intentionally left blank ...
Page 10: ...This page is intentionally left blank ...
Page 12: ...This page is intentionally left blank ...
Page 34: ...This page is intentionally left blank ...
Page 40: ...This page is intentionally left blank ...
Page 60: ...Theory of Device Operation 4 6 C141 E171 03EN Figure 4 3 Circuit Configuration ...
Page 190: ...Interface 5 114 C141 E171 03EN g d f f d e Figure 5 7 Normal DMA data transfer ...
Page 240: ...This page is intentionally left blank ...
Page 244: ...This page is intentionally left blank ...
Page 246: ...This page is intentionally left blank ...
Page 250: ...This page is intentionally left blank ...
Page 252: ...This page is intentionally left blank ...
Page 253: ......
Page 254: ......